Understanding the Composition of Smoke:
- The Invisible Culprit
Smoke is not just a visible sign of fire; it’s a complex mixture of particles, chemicals, and gases produced when materials burn. Different materials yield different types of smoke, each with its unique composition. From the soot particles that settle on surfaces to the harmful gases released during combustion, the invisible components of smoke pose challenges during the restoration process.
- Penetrating the Unseen: Smoke Residue and Its Effects
Smoke doesn’t limit its impact to the immediate vicinity of the fire. It can penetrate walls, ceilings, and other structural elements, leaving behind residue that continues to damage surfaces and affect indoor air quality long after the flames are extinguished. Understanding the behavior of smoke residue is crucial for effective remediation.
The Role of Water in Fire Damage:
- Water Damage, the Unintended Consequence
While battling a fire, water is often used to control and extinguish flames. However, this necessary step can lead to additional complications. Water damage, resulting from firefighting efforts, can create a breeding ground for mold and weaken structural elements. The delicate balance between addressing fire and water damage requires a comprehensive remediation strategy.
